As the Shadow Rises
by Katy Rose Pool
A sequel to the critically acclaimed There Will Come a Darkness finds the heroes forging new alliances and nursing old wounds when the Last Prophet’s haunting vision directs them to pursue long-lost sources of magic in the City of Mercy.

Blood & Honey
by Shelby Mahurin
A follow-up to the best-selling Serpent & Dove finds fugitives Lou, Reid, Coco and Ansel splitting up to recruit allies against the Dames Blanches, an effort that is complicated by Morgane's lethal game of cat and mouse.

Fable
by Adrienne Young
A first entry in a planned duology by the author of the Sky in the Deep series finds the teen daughter of a seaside village’s most powerful trader testing the limits of skills imparted by her late mother to reconnect with her father and establish her place among his crew.

The Inheritance Games
by Jennifer Barnes
When a Connecticut teenager inherits vast wealth and an eccentric estate from the richest man in Texas, she must also live with his surviving family and solve a series of puzzles to discover how she earned her inheritance.

Legendborn
by Tracy Deonn
Wanting to escape her previous life after the accidental death of her mother, 16-year-old Bree enrolls in a program for high school students at the local university before her witness to a magical attack reveals her undiscovered powers as well as sinister truths about her mother’s death.

The Lost Book of the White
by Cassandra Clare
When their peaceful family life is upended by the theft of the powerful Book of the White, Magnus Bane and Alec Lightwood pursue the culprits to Shanghai, where Magnus’ magic is destabilized by a wound from a mysterious weapon.

Majesty
by Katharine McGee
A sequel to the best-selling American Royals finds Beatrice grappling with everything she has lost for the sake of her ultimate crown, while party-princess Samantha pursues a handsome prince, Nina avoids the palace and Daphne guards a future-risking secret.

The Other Side of the Sky
by Amie Kaufman
A first entry in a planned duology by two best-selling authors finds the prince of a sky city and an earth goddess linked by a terrifying prophecy that forces them to choose between saving their people or succumbing to their forbidden love.
